Unity Shuts Out Sioux Center

Sheldon, Iowa — The Uunity logonity Christian Knights defeated the Sioux Center Warriors 3-0 in Class 2A District 1 baseball action Saturday afternoon in Sheldon

Unity Christian would jump to a quick 1-0 lead after lead off batter Matt Griffith launched one over the center field wall. Sioux Center pitcher Blake Kamerman and Unity pitcher Griffith would both duel until the 6th inning, where Cole Vande Vegte for Unity Christian would hit a stand up double to left-center, then later steal 3rd, then home to give the Knights a 2-0 lead. Unity would add one more in the 7, and come away with the 3-0 win.

Matthew Griffith got the win for the Knights, giving up just 3 hits and walking 4 while striking out 11 for the complete game shutout.

Blake Kamerman took the loss for the Warriors. Kamerman went the distance giving up 2 earned runs on 4 hits while striking out 7.

With the win, Unity improves to 15-14 on the season and will face Hinton Tuesday night at 7:00 pm at Hinton.

Sioux Center ends their year at 10-19
